Além disso, o produto testado foi capaz de promover a obliteração dos túbulos dentinários e a redução da rugosidade superficial. / The complete understanding and effective and definitive treatment for dentin hypersensitivity are not yet established. The challenge is to find a substance that effectively eliminates the painful sensation not allowing their recurrence. The purpose of this in vitro study was to determine the efficacy of Clinpro XT® in reducing dentin and evaluate the strength of the product acid challenges. The obliteration of the dentinal tubules, and surface roughness after application of the product, were also evaluated. 65 intact human third molars were used for the preparation of 65 samples were bound to a hydraulic pressure system to measure the dentin after the following steps: (1) sample preparation; (2) treatment with 37% phosphoric acid for 30 seconds; (3) application of Clinpro XT®; (4) first; (5) and second (6) third challenges acids, respectively. The samples were randomly divided into 5 groups (n = 13) according to the different acid solutions: refrigerant cola, natural lemon juice, wine vinegar, white wine and energy drink. 10 thirds additional molars were used to prepare 20 samples for analysis of the degree of obliteration of the dentinal tubules, by scanning electron microscopy, and surface roughness, using a roughness. It can be concluded that Clinpro XT® was effective in reducing dentinal permeability and this effect was maintained after three challenges with different acids. Furthermore, the test product is capable of promoting the obliteration of the dentinal tubules and reduce surface roughness.

Quantitative Phase Imaging of Magnetic Nanostructures Using Off-Axis Electron Holography

January 2010 (has links)
abstract: The research of this dissertation has involved the nanoscale quantitative characterization of patterned magnetic nanostructures and devices using off-axis electron holography and Lorentz microscopy. The investigation focused on different materials of interest, including monolayer Co nanorings, multilayer Co/Cu/Py (Permalloy, Ni81Fe19) spin-valve nanorings, and notched Py nanowires, which were fabricated via a standard electron-beam lithography (EBL) and lift-off process. Magnetization configurations and reversal processes of Co nanorings, with and without slots, were observed. Vortex-controlled switching behavior with stepped hysteresis loops was identified, with clearly defined onion states, vortex states, flux-closure (FC) states, and Omega states. Two distinct switching mechanisms for the slotted nanorings, depending on applied field directions relative to the slot orientations, were attributed to the vortex chirality and shape anisotropy. Micromagnetic simulations were in good agreement with electron holography observations of the Co nanorings, also confirming the switching field of 700-800 Oe. Co/Cu/Py spin-valve slotted nanorings exhibited different remanent states and switching behavior as a function of the different directions of the applied field relative to the slots. At remanent state, the magnetizations of Co and Py layers were preferentially aligned in antiparallel coupled configuration, with predominant configurations in FC or onion states. Two-step and three-step hysteresis loops were quantitatively determined for nanorings with slots perpendicular, or parallel to the applied field direction, respectively, due to the intrinsic coercivity difference and interlayer magnetic coupling between Co and Py layers. The field to reverse both layers was on the order of ~800 Oe. Domain-wall (DW) motion within Py nanowires (NWs) driven by an in situ magnetic field was visualized and quantified. Different aspects of DW behavior, including nucleation, injection, pinning, depinning, relaxation, and annihilation, occurred depending on applied field strength. A unique asymmetrical DW pinning behavior was recognized, depending on DW chirality relative to the sense of rotation around the notch. The transverse DWs relaxed into vortex DWs, followed by annihilation in a reversed field, which was in agreement with micromagnetic simulations. Overall, the success of these studies demonstrated the capability of off-axis electron holography to provide valuable insights for understanding magnetic behavior on the nanoscale. / Dissertation/Thesis / Ph.D. Materials Science and Engineering 2010

Les mesures ont notamment permis de vérifier l'additivité des deux procédés de déformation. / Strain engineering is now considered as one of the most important boosters of microelectronics among other technologies such as SOI (Silicon On Insulator) and high-κ metal gates. By applying a stress in the channel of MOSFET (Metal Oxyde Semiconductor Field Effect Transistor) devices, the charge carriers mobility can be significantly increased. Consequently, there is now a need for a strain metrology at the nanometer scale. Dark-field electron holography is a TEM (Transmission Electron Microscopy) technique invented in 2008 that allows to map strain with micrometer field-of-view and nanometer spatial resolution. In this thesis, the technique was developed on the CEA Titan microscope. First, different developements were carried out concerning the sample preparation, the illumination/acquisition conditions and the reconstruction of the holograms. The sensitivity and the accuracy of the technique were evaluated through the characterization of Si_{1-x}Ge_{x} layers epitaxied on Si and by comparing the results with mechanical finite element simulations. Then, the technique was applied to the study of annealed SiGe(C)/Si superlattices that are used in the construction of new 3D architectures such as multichannel or multiwires transistors. The influence of the different relaxation mechanisms on the strain especially Ge interdiffusion and β-SiC clusters formation was investigated. Finally, dark-field electron holography was applied to the characterization of uniaxially strained pMOS transistors by SiN liners and recessed SiGe sources and drains. The measurements allowed to confirm the strain additivity of the two processes.

Mikrostruktura a vlastnosti moderních plynule odlévaných hliníkových slitin. / Microstructure and properties of enhanced twin-roll cast aluminium alloys.

Poková, Michaela January 2014 (has links)
Three aluminium alloys from AA3003 series modified by zirconium were pre- pared by twin-roll casting. The role of composition, heat treatment and deforma- tion by cold-rolling or equal channel angular pressing on evolution of microstruc- ture and mechanical properties were studied. High density of α-Al(Mn,Fe)Si pre- cipitates formed during annealing between 300 ◦ C and 500 ◦ C. Coherent Al3Zr particles precipitated during annealing at 450 ◦ C with slow heating rate. Recrys- tallization resistance of deformed alloys was enhanced by either Al3Zr precipitates formed before deformation or by α-Al(Mn,Fe)Si particles nucleating simultane- ously with recrystallization. 1

Apesar disso, o seu uso não alterou a propriedade elástica das mesmas. / The objective of this study was to compare the performance of aesthetic orthodontic ligatures/modules of 4 commercial brands, after 30 days in the oral cavity, with the use of conventional and whitening dentifrice to evaluate: color change by spectrophotometry; the ultrastructure of the surface by Scanning Electron Microscopy (SEM); elastic property by the tensile test. The following brands were evaluated: American Orthodontics, 3M Unitek, Orthotechnology and Morelli Orthodontics. Twenty patients who were included in the inclusion criteria were selected after sample calculation. Patients received, at random, with the aid of the Shooter accessory (TP Orthodontics, La Porte, IN, USA) ligatures on elements 13, 23, 33, 43, 32, 31, 41 e 42 and whitening dentifrice Colgate Luminous White (Colgate-Palmolive Indústria e Comércio, São Bernardo do Campo, SP, Brazil), which was used for 30 days (test group). After this period, the ligatures were removed, stored (in artificial saliva) and immediately submitted to the tests. Patients were then given conventional toothpaste Colgate Maximum Anti-caries Protection (Colgate-Palmolive Indústria e Comércio, São Bernardo do Campo, SP, Brazil). This was the control group. Once again, after 30 days, the modules were removed, stored and submitted to assays. Ligatures inserted into the canine brackets were evaluated by the spectrophotometer (Vita Easyshade Zahnfabrik, Bad Säckingen, Germany) to evaluate the color change. After this step, the ligatures of each brand, which presented greater and lesser color variation, both with the whitening dentifrice as well as the conventional one, and new ligatures, were selected for qualitative evaluation with the visualization by the Scanning Electron Microscope (EVO 50, Carl Zeiss, Cambridge, England). The ligatures that were inserted in the lower incisor brackets were subjected to the tensile test by the Universal Mechanical Testing Machine (EMIC DL 2000, São José dos Pinhais, PR, Brazil). The findings were submitted to ANOVA statistical analysis and Duncan\'s complementary test at a significance level of 5%. The results showed that the whitening dentifrice failed to effectively improve the color stability of aesthetic orthodontic ligatures. The final value for ΔE (total color change) for all brands was > 3.3 which indicates a change clinically perceptible by the human eye and signaling the replacement of the material for aesthetic reasons. In relation to the SEM the images obtained were heterogeneous and did not allow to characterize a standard for one or the other dentifrice. Regarding the tensile test, there was better performance for the brands 3M Unitek and American Orthodontics. The type of dentifrice, whitening or conventional did not alter the elastic property between the brands studied. It can be concluded from the present research that the whitening dentifrice was not able to change the color stability in the 4 brands evaluated for a period of 30 days. The qualitative evaluation by SEM did not allow the conclusion that the abrasiveness of the whitening dentifrice caused damage to the surface of the ligatures. Despite this, their use did not alter their elastic property.

Ces résultats ont permis d'apporter de nouvelles informations sur les mécanismes de fonctionnement des mémoires résistives, ainsi que sur la technique de polarisation in situ. / In this work, we address the current challenges encountered during in situ Transmission Electron Microscopy characterization of emerging non volatile data storage technologies. Recent innovation on in situ TEM holders based on silicon micro chips have led to great improvements compared to previous technologies. Still, in situ is a particularly complicated technique and experiments are extremely difficult to implement. This work provides new solutions to perform live observations at the atomic scale during both heating and biasing of a specimen inside the TEM. This was made possible through several improvements performed at different stages of the in situ TEM experiments. The main focus of this PhD concerned the issues faced during in situ biasing of a nanometer size resistive memory device. This was made possible through hardware investigation, sample preparation method developments, and in situ biasing TEM experiments.First, a new sample preparation method has been developed specifically to perform in situ heating experiments. Through this work, live crystallization of a GeTe phase change Memory Material is observed in the TEM. This allowed to obtain valuable information for the development of chalcogenide based Phase Change Resistive Memories. Then, new chips dedicated to in situ biasing experiments have been developed and manufactured. The FIB sample preparation is studied in order to improve electrical operation in the TEM. Quantitative TEM measurements are then performed on a reference PN junction to demonstrate the capabilities of this new in situ biasing experimental setup. By implementing these improvements performed on the TEM in situ biasing technique, results are obtained during live operation of a Conductive Bridge Resistive Memory device. This allowed to present new information on the resistive memories functioning mechanisms, as well as the in situ TEM characterization technique itself.
